The class returned must be a subclass of psycopg2. See Connection and cursor factories for details. A default factory for the connection can . STATUS_BEGIN, STATUS_READY if.
Equal(self.conn. get_transaction_status (), psycopg2. Thread-safe connection manager for psycopgconnections. This page provides Python code examples for psycopg2. The most reliable way to get the state of the connection is to call get_transaction_status () that will . Extensions to the DB API - Psycopg 2. Here are the examples of the python api psycopg2. The argument must be a subclass of psycopg2.
It is now possible to call ` get_transaction_status ()` on closed connections. Fixed unsafe access to object names causing assertion failures in Python debug . I was thinking about catching psycopg2. How can I check for open transactions on a psycopgconnection?
It is a wrapper around the actual psycopgdriver, and connection object. PostgreSQL database adapter for the Python. Now, if a psycopgerror occurs, and the file descriptor has gone ba. We have released Psycopg.
The library uses psycopgconnections in asynchronous mode internally. Get backend transaction status . Operationalerror: ( psycopg2.operationalerror) Ssl Syscall Error: Eof Detected. If you use the connection pool it . I noticed that connection.
You can also find a few other specialized adapters in the psycopg2. Return the current session transaction status as an . Queue try: from psycopgimport extensions as pg_extensions except. Do not return connection . Instead I get the check close at least calling poll() first, or checking get_transaction_status. Note: This module requires psycopgto be.
However, this requires a patched psycopgat time of writing.
Ingen kommentarer:
Send en kommentar
Bemærk! Kun medlemmer af denne blog kan sende kommentarer.